LS to discuss inflation, RS to take up issue of internal security situation

The Lok Sabha will take up discussion today on price rise under rule 184 which provides for voting. The opposition BJP has been demanding for such a discussion on the issue.A motion by NDA leaders Yashwant Sinha and Sharad Yadav will be moved in the House for discussion. Parliamentary Affairs Minister Pawan Kumar Bansal told reporters that the government is hopeful that the House will work smoothly. He added that government is ready to discuss all the issues raised by the Opposition. The Rajya Sabha is to take up discussion on internal security today. Yesterday, a host of issues stalled the proceedings of the two houses of Parliament The issues ranged from price rise to demand for dismissal of Mayawati government and immediate execution of Ajmal Kasab . In the Lok Sabha, SP members trooped into the well seeking dismissal of the Mayawati government in poll-bound Uttar Pradesh for committing atrocities against farmers. Members of BSP followed suit by carrying placards, blaming Congress-led government for the poor conditions of the peasantry. They demanded immediate passage of the Land Acquisition Bill. Shiv Sena MPs stormed the well raising slogans demanding that Mumbai terror attack culprit Ajmal Kasab and Parliament attack convict Afzal Guru be hanged immediately. In the Rajya Sabha it was trouble from the beginning. Opposition BJP members made a strong pitch in the house for the suspension of Question Hour to discuss price rise. The situation was no different when the two houses met after every adjournment. This led to their adjournment for the day.
